    The thing about Wendy William is that she was willing to burn bridges. She knew the celebs she talked about watched her show and would probably bar her from having access to certain spaces because of what she said on her show, AND THEY DID. Nowadays, the girls are trynna keep all those revenue streams open and need to be publicly nice to people to keep their jobs and get the next one (thnx gig economy). I think it's a double edged sword because Wendy only really had the Wendy Show at a certain point and wasn't able to dip her toes in projects outside of producing Lifetime movies. I don't blame the new entertainers for molding their style to survive in this industry long term but there is definitely some noticeable ass-kissing in mainstream hosting, or they tip-toe around what they want to really say to avoid "getting cancelled" even if their opinion wouldn't be offensive or unpopular.

    I agree - and ziwe I like her, I always wonder how she’s be live or with an audience. But for Wendy it also took 20 years on the radio to build that clout and working out multiple formats of the Wendy show to lock in the one that became a hit. She comes from the era of Shock Jocks - and because she made big advertising money in radio, that gave her leverage on tv. I’m aging myself but I had just moved to Philly for college right before she left *power to start the tv show. Now in this era, reality tv and influencer culture obscures the “realness” and profitability of what we see, because at the end of the day, Wendy is a actually a tenured broadcaster and journalist that broke the rules, and THAT made her iconic, but now it’ll simply be anyone that goes viral.

    I think people like Wendy and Joan Rivers were good at being the voices of dissent against celebrity ass kissing before social media but it doesn't feel as fresh when there's a random gay on twitter with a Lana icon reading your fave with laser precision and 200k retweets. It was also a novelty for the celebs since they were more coddled and sheltered from their critics a lot more back in the day. Mariah and Whitney seemed equal parts amused and annoyed with Wendy during their radio interactions, for example. Now celebs have nowhere to hide from the gossip, hurtful comments and memes so they aren't as willing to joke around about it.

    I'm only in the biography part of the video but I wanted to add that the fact that there was no where she wasn't willing to go also got her in trouble from time to time. Her radio show got cancelled twice (on two different radio station). At the same time, some of the controversal things she said turned out to be true. Like she called out Whitney Houston for being on crack back when she was still America's sweetheart, but eventually we realized it was true. She also called Destiny's child Beyonce and the girls well before Beyonce went solo. I was shocked when she got her own TV show but I knew those higher ups knew exactly what they were getting into.
